CDNS
Cadence is a leading electronic design automation (EDA) and Intelligent System Design company that provides hardware, software, and intellectual property for electronic design. It serves multiple industries including aerospace, automotive, data centers, 5G, hyperscale computing, and life sciences with design tools, IP, and analytics. Headquartered in San Jose, California, Cadence operates globally to enable complex chip, board, and system design through AI-driven and multiphysics capabilities.
